Description

3-Chloro-2-Hydroxy-5-(Trifluoromethyl)Pyridine is a high-value, multi-functional heterocyclic building block characterized by its unique combination of chlorine, hydroxyl, and trifluoromethyl substituents. This compound is essential for the synthesis of advanced agrochemicals and pharmaceuticals, where its structure imparts critical biological activity and favorable physicochemical properties. It is primarily sought after by R&D chemists and process development scientists in the agrochemical and pharmaceutical industries for creating novel active ingredients and intermediates.

Application

  • Agrochemical Intermediate: A key synthon for the development of next-generation herbicides, fungicides, and insecticides, leveraging the bioactivity of the pyridine core and trifluoromethyl group.
  • Pharmaceutical Building Block: Used in medicinal chemistry for the synthesis of drug candidates, particularly in areas requiring fluorine-containing motifs for enhanced metabolic stability and bioavailability.
  • Ligand Synthesis: Serves as a precursor for creating specialized ligands used in catalysis and material science applications.
  • Organic Synthesis Research: Employed in academic and industrial R&D for constructing complex heterocyclic systems and exploring novel chemical reactions.
  • Fine Chemical Production: An intermediate in the multi-step synthesis of other high-value specialty chemicals and performance materials.

Basic Information

Product Name 3-Chloro-2-Hydroxy-5-(Trifluoromethyl)Pyridine
CAS No. 76041-71-9
Molecular Formula C6H3ClF3NO
Molecular Weight 197.54 g/mol
Synonyms 2-Hydroxy-3-chloro-5-(trifluoromethyl)pyridine; 3-Chloro-5-(trifluoromethyl)pyridin-2-ol; 3-Chloro-2-hydroxy-5-trifluoromethylpyridine; 5-(Trifluoromethyl)-3-chloropyridin-2-ol; 2-Pyridinol, 3-chloro-5-(trifluoromethyl)-; 76041-71-9; 3-Chloro-5-trifluoromethyl-2-hydroxypyridine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to exclude moisture. Keep away from incompatible materials.
